Abstract

L'invention concerne un procédé de réalisation d'une application de tube spiralé utilisant une rétroaction, ledit procédé comprenant le transport d'une colonne de production spiralée le long d'un trou de forage et l'obtention de données de mesure de vibration basées sur des vibrations à l'intérieur de la colonne de production spiralée. Le procédé comprend en outre l'utilisation, pendant l'application de tube spiralé, d'une rétroaction basée sur les données de mesure de vibrations. Le procédé comprend en outre l'utilisation d'un dispositif de commande mécanique pour régler un élément variable de l'application de tube spiralé sur la base de la rétroaction.
